Web1st step. The first cervical vertebra is also known as the atlas (C1). The first cervical vertebra articulates with the occipital bone of the skull. The type of projections of the occipital bone that articulate with the first cervical vertebra are called the occipital condyles . The alternate name for the second cervical vertebra is the axis (C2). The atlas (C1) is the topmost vertebra, and along with the axis forms the joint connecting the skull and spine. It lacks a vertebral body, spinous process, and discs either superior or inferior to it.
